google / site-kit-wp

Site Kit is a one-stop solution for WordPress users to use everything Google has to offer to make them successful on the web.
https://sitekit.withgoogle.com
Apache License 2.0
1.23k stars 286 forks source link

Address copy/formatting inconsistencies in "subtle" notifications? #8747

Closed techanvil closed 18 hours ago

techanvil commented 4 months ago

Feature Description

At present the copy/formatting in the existent "subtle" notifications is a little inconsistent.

SetupSuccessSubtleNotification:

image

GA4AdSenseLinkedNotification:

image

AudienceSegmentationSetupSuccessSubtleNotification (PR Storybook instance for pre-merge access):

image

It's not entirely clear what the outcome here should be as there's a bit of room for interpretation based on the style guide for punctuation (see below).

Style guide:

"Skip periods and unnecessary punctuation

To help readers scan text, avoid using periods and other unnecessary punctuation.

Avoid using periods to end single sentences, particularly in: - Labels - Tooltip text - Bulleted lists - Dialog body text - Hyperlinked text

Use periods on: - Multiple sentences - Long or complex sentences, if it suits the context - Any sentence followed by a link"


Do not alter or remove anything below. The following sections will be managed by moderators only.

Acceptance criteria

Implementation Brief

Test Coverage

QA Brief

Changelog entry

jimmymadon commented 4 months ago

@techanvil I agree with your suggestions. The period in the lastAudienceSegmentationSetupSuccessSubtleNotification seems to be fine.

benbowler commented 4 months ago

It's worth considering #8725, as this will help introduce consistency is styles across SubtleNotifications (although not the copy).

nfmohit commented 4 months ago

AC ✅

eugene-manuilov commented 3 months ago

IB ✔️

hussain-t commented 1 week ago

Hi @benbowler, the storybook stories links are broken in the QAB. Could you fix them?

benbowler commented 5 days ago

@hussain-t @mohitwp fixed the links.

mohitwp commented 4 days ago

QA Update ✅

![image](https://github.com/user-attachments/assets/8bc303f3-451a-40b5-8474-8c66395a7fca) ![image](https://github.com/user-attachments/assets/81ec0a7f-09a6-429c-9e78-b3897cae7bbb) ![image](https://github.com/user-attachments/assets/d2e7e2b9-0713-4233-9417-7f369d2c7aa5)